Wood Framing Repair in Wilmington, NC
Wood framing repair services focus on restoring the structural integrity of a building’s wooden framework. This type of repair typically involves fixing damaged or rotting wooden beams, studs, or joists that support walls, floors, and roofs. Projects can range from addressing minor issues caused by moisture or pests to more extensive repairs after storm damage or foundational shifts. Property owners often seek these services to ensure their homes remain safe, stable, and compliant with building standards, especially when noticing signs of deterioration such as sagging ceilings, warped walls, or visible wood decay.
Before requesting wood framing repairs,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age and whether the affected areas are critical to the overall structure. It’s important to consider if repairs will require partial or complete replacement of framing components and to clarify the scope of work involved. Additionally, understanding the potential impact on neighboring areas, the need for inspection prior to repairs, and any necessary permits can help homeowners make informed decisions about maintaining their property’s stability and safety.

Common Wood Framing Repair Jobs
Wall framing repair - addresses damaged or bowed wall structures to restore stability.
Floor joist repair - reinforces or replaces compromised floor framing for safety and support.
Roof framing repair - fixes sagging or damaged roof supports to maintain structural integrity.
Cracked or rotted wood repair - removes and replaces deteriorated framing components to prevent further damage.
Structural reinforcement - adds support to weakened framing to improve overall building stability.
Foundation wall framing - repairs or replaces framing around foundation walls to prevent shifting or settling.
Wood Framing Repair Questions
What is wood framing repair? It involves fixing damaged or rotting wooden structural elements in a building’s framework to ensure stability and safety.
When is wood framing repair necessary? Repair is needed when signs like sagging walls, cracks, or wood rot appear in the framing structure.
What types of projects require wood framing repair? Common projects include home additions, remodeling, or fixing damage caused by moisture or pests.
How can I tell if my wood framing needs repair? Visible signs such as warped or cracked wood, sagging ceilings, or uneven floors indicate potential framing issues.
